DESCRIPTION: Possibly by Couaillet family, Saint-Nicolas-d'Aliermont, carriage clock, 8 day, time and grande sonnerie strike with repeat and alarm, spring driven movement with jeweled lever escapement in a glazed Cannelee case, gilt matte dial mask, gilt dial with roman numerals and cast dial center with small subsidiary dial for the alarm, blued steel hands.
CONDITION: This case has been brightly polished and re-gilded. Original silvered platform is intact. There is a selector switch in the base for Grand Sonnerie, Petite Sonnerie, or Silence. The original gilt dial with wear to some of the painted numerals. Strikes hours and quarters. The clock is running a the time of our brief test.
